	Summary: I don't know why every singled backend had to redeclare its own DataLayout. There was a virtual getDataLayout() on the common base TargetMachine, the default implementation returned nullptr. It was not clear from this that we could assume at call site that a DataLayout will be available with each Target. Now getDataLayout() is no longer virtual and return a pointer to the DataLayout member of the common base TargetMachine. I plan to turn it into a reference in a future patch. The only backend that didn't have a DataLayout previsouly was the CPPBackend. It now initializes the default DataLayout. This commit is NFC for all the other backends.
